A web-based Python application


Python comes with a simple HTTP library that is perfect for creating a small web application. The web application, also known as a web service, is designed to provide a simple set of functionality: receive data, store it, and e-mail to confirm that it has received the data.

In Chapter 3, Central Air and Heating Thermostat, we used the HTTP server functionality of the Arduino to query the thermostat for data. In this chapter, we will be reversing the actions, where the Arduino will be posting to the Raspberry Pi.

Setting up SMTP

We recommend using an external e-mail service and connecting to it.

While you can host an SMTP server on your Raspberry Pi, you may find spam blockers will prevent the email for reaching its target.

Note

SMTP stands for Simple Mail Transfer Protocol. An SMTP server is an application that handles sending e-mails on the device it is installed on, for example, the Raspberry Pi.
